Plot Synopsis

Host Bert Kreischer crashes vacations, taking the tourists to the coolest spots in town, the hidden gems that only locals know about and adventures that they would not have found on their own. In each 30-minute episode, Bert travels to a new city and convinces two random people to spontaneously agree to a three-day dream vacation with him instead of the ordinary vacation they had planned for themselves. As the best tour guide around, Kreischer delivers an action-packed itinerary, stacked with VIP access, accommodations, gourmet food, unexpected twists and celebrity appearances. And forget about guidebooks and tour buses, because every trip flip is designed to get vacationers off the beaten path, out of their comfort zones, and into mind-blowing, life-changing experiences. In Season 1, Bert: hangs with a couple at Lover's Beach in Cabo San Lucas, Mexico; paddles to shore with the lucky couple and members of the Outrigger Canoe Club in Oahu, HI; eats king cake on Bourbon Street in New Orleans; goes behind the scenes at a Farmer's Market in San Francisco; enjoys Paragon sailing through the waters in Maui, HI; and flips trips for vacations at other destinations, like Cancun and San Diego. TRIP FLIP returned for its second season on Sunday, March 17, 2013 at 8pm ET, with Travel Channel showing back-to-back new episodes -- the first highlighting a trip to Australia's Great Barrier Reef and the second one featuring Seattle. Travel Channel broadcast the Season 3 premiere of TRIP FLIP on Wednesday, April 23, 2014 at 9pm ET/PT, as the cable channel showed back-to-back new episodes. In the Season 3 opener, Bert took Floridians Angela and Sara on an insane adventure to Idaho that begins with a major shot of adrenaline: BASE jumping off the Perrine Bridge. In the night's second episode, Bert took an Idaho-based couple, Kimi and Gabe, on a tropical, high-speed adventure in Costa Rica, as they zip lined through the jungle and tamed class IV rapids. TRIP FLIP returned for its fourth season on Tuesday, June 2, 2015 from 8-9pm ET/PT, as Travel Channel premiered back-to-back new episodes. In the season opener (8pm), "Michigan: Pasties, Puppies & the Plunge," Bert takes a warm-blooded Louisiana couple on a crazy outdoor adventure in the middle of the Michigan winter -- from dogsledding to plunging into a freezing cold lake wearing practically nothing. In the night's second new episode (8:30pm), "New Orleans: Breakneck Speeds, Boils & Beads," Bert takes a couple on a quest for celebration -- and beads -- throughout the whole state of Louisiana, from swamps to the heart of the French Quarter. In the rest of Season 4, Bert encourages two regular people to spontaneously agree to a once-in-a-lifetime trip in those locations: Alabama/Talladega; Fiji; Japan; North Carolina; Ohio/Great Lakes; South Africa; Tanzania/Zanzibar; Texas; Utah/Lake Powell; Vietnam; and Wisconsin.

On Tuesday, June 23, 2015 from 8-9pm ET/PT, Travel Channel premiered "Vietnam: Jamming, Junks & the Jungle," a special one-hour episode of TRIP FLIP. Bert treks through Vietnam with two buskers from Cleveland in tow. They sail the waters of Halong Bay, get their ears cleaned on the streets of Hanoi, hike through the jungle, and sleep in a 3-million-year-old cave.
